IntroductionMicromerchants, also known as individual entrepreneurs or small business owners, have become increasingly prevalent in today's digital economy. To manage their businesses effectively, micromerchants rely on sophisticated software solutions known as micromerchant management systems.

What is a Micromerchant Management System?A micromerchant management system is a comprehensive software platform that provides micromerchants with a centralized hub to manage all aspects of their business operations, including:
Inventory management
Order processing
Customer relationship management (CRM)
Marketing and advertising
Financial reporting

Benefits of Using a Micromerchant Management SystemMicromerchant management systems offer numerous benefits to small businesses, including:
Increased efficiency: Automates routine tasks, such as order processing and inventory tracking, freeing up time for micromerchants to focus on growing their business.
Improved customer service: Provides tools for managing customer inquiries, tracking orders, and offering personalized experiences.
Enhanced data management: Centralizes all business data in one place, providing micromerchants with a comprehensive view of their operations.
Increased profitability: Optimizes business processes, reduces costs, and increases sales through effective marketing and advertising.

Choosing the Right Micromerchant Management SystemWhen selecting a micromerchant management system, it is important to consider the following factors:
Business size and industry: Choose a system that is tailored to the specific needs of your business.
Features and functionality: Ensure the system offers the features and functionality you require.
Ease of use: The system should be user-friendly and easy to navigate.
Cost: Factor in the cost of the system, including monthly fees, implementation costs, and ongoing support.

How to Implement a Micromerchant Management SystemSuccessfully implementing a micromerchant management system involves the following steps:
Define business goals: Determine how the system will help you achieve your business objectives.
Choose the right system: Select a system that meets your specific needs and budget.
Prepare your data: Clean and organize your business data before importing it into the system.
Configure the system: Set up the system according to your business requirements.
Train staff: Provide user training to ensure your team can use the system effectively.
Go live: Launch the system and monitor its performance regularly.

Best Practices for Using a Micromerchant Management SystemTo maximize the benefits of using a micromerchant management system, consider the following best practices:
Regularly update inventory: Keep track of your inventory to avoid overselling or understocking.
Process orders promptly: Respond to orders quickly to ensure customer satisfaction.
Maintain customer relationships: Use the CRM functionality to track customer interactions and provide personalized experiences.
Analyze performance data: Use reports to identify areas for improvement and make informed decisions.
Seek support when needed: Do not hesitate to contact the software provider or a consultant if you encounter any challenges.

ConclusionMicromerchant management systems are essential tools for micromerchants to manage their businesses efficiently and effectively. By choosing the right system, implementing it properly, and following best practices, micromerchants can streamline their operations, increase customer satisfaction, and grow their businesses successfully.
